Transaction 18fa93ecd2d4c50c0e17dfaebbe8b1c87606e9a338c34789511310deaa1cec57

1 Input
2 Outputs
  • 18fa93ecd2d4c50c0e17dfaebbe8b1c87606e9a338c34789511310deaa1cec57:0
  • value  55703733
    address  1EdSWLS3k1VrD3KmxNjFogjXurxRhnAVez
  • 18fa93ecd2d4c50c0e17dfaebbe8b1c87606e9a338c34789511310deaa1cec57:1
  • value  2487386267
    address  1QBK3YYttTJ1QYrNeYLMoBKh7gv3wQmkZP